Default Ford Ranger 2004 Edge 6 CD Changer Problems

Hi!
The ad for this clean Ranger said that everything worked. Well... the 6 CD changer won't receive (nor reject) a CD. When it displays, "Insert CD # (Whatever)", there's a clicking sound but the CD is not received into the chamber. I can push it in with my finger, but the display still reads "NO CD", and... after trying to receive the CD (the clicking noise), the noise changes to more of a "I'm trying to now kick this CD out"... and actually, little by little, it does just enough for me to grab it with y fingernail. (Like a small hammer was tapping it or trying to tap it out of the slot). I guess this means a total remove and replace? .... John

Yes. The 6 disc in my 03 did the same thing. I had to take the whole CD case out of the radio and disassemble it just to get all 6 of my cd's out. I tried to roll around with just the AM/FM part of the radio, but eventually the entire radio just started shutting off for no reason, so I had to take it out and put in a new aftermarket head unit. Haven't had a problem since, and even though I'm a stickler for keeping my trucks original, I haven't even looked back. That radio was such a pain in the rear and they're really not worth fixing. I picked up my Pioneer for a mere $70, about what you would pay for a used factory 6 disc that will probably do the same thing eventually.

It would say 6discs somewhere on there, I have the 6disce, wasn't working, so I open it up, and see what was happening when powered. Well the arm that lifted the CDs didn't work, and would spit out a new CD in like 20seconds after pushing it in. The arm is used to pick up the discs from their holders to where they're played. And it would always make a 'searching' sound, thats soo annoying. The Fix: Dunno, just need a new CD player.
^Posted this the other day on another topic, this is your problem. And after awhile they end up no even accepting CDs, and will just keep on searching for CDs everytime you turn the truck on, or click the CD button.
